Transaction e15a08b3dd310bcb19a77052dadceedb2e64841bbea2736990c90f4f93506622
1 Input
1 Output
-
e15a08b3dd310bcb19a77052dadceedb2e64841bbea2736990c90f4f93506622:0
- value
- 99973882
- script pubkey
- OP_0 OP_PUSHBYTES_20 55c842486c73b34a9e3d9c515707e87687a7b176
- address
- bc1q2hyyyjrvwwe5483an3g4wplgw6r60vtk9tkt6d